Group 1: Company Overview - Afya (AFYA) currently holds a Zacks Rank of 2 (Buy) and has an A grade for Value, indicating strong potential for value investors [2]. - The stock is trading at a P/E ratio of 9.88, significantly lower than the industry average P/E of 21.01 [2]. - Over the past 52 weeks, AFYA's Forward P/E has fluctuated between a high of 18.02 and a low of 9.01, with a median of 10.98 [2]. Group 2: Valuation Metrics - Afya has a PEG ratio of 0.42, which is lower than the industry's average PEG of 1.24, suggesting it may be undervalued relative to its expected earnings growth [2]. - The PEG ratio for AFYA has ranged from a high of 1.02 to a low of 0.39 over the past year, with a median of 0.57 [2]. - The P/B ratio for AFYA is 2.17, compared to the industry average P/B of 3.60, indicating an attractive valuation [3]. - AFYA's P/B ratio has varied from a high of 2.87 to a low of 1.90 in the past year, with a median of 2.18 [3].
